Initial Findings Suggest Lost Achaemenid Mines May Be Discovered in Western Iran
Saturday, 12 April 2025 10:37
Archaeologists have identified three mines in the Zagros mountain range in the Abdanan, Ilam province, which they believe could be the long-lost Achaemenid mines. These mines are thought to have been the primary source of stone used in the construction of Darius the Great's palace in the ancient city of Susa.

Ancient 3,000-Year-Old Stone Tablet on Display in Taq-e Bostan, Kermanshah
Wednesday, 23 October 2024 08:32
Kermanshah, Iran - An ancient stone inscription known as "Kuduru," or the border stone of "Marduk Apal Aydin," has been unveiled at the Taq-e Bostan Stone Museum in Kermanshah. This remarkable artifact, discovered in Sarpol-e Zahab, dates back over 3,000 years.
